The Significance of Shah Rukh Khan’s Cinematic Comeback
SRK’s Enduring Global Appeal
Over three decades, Shah Rukh Khan has established himself as Bollywood's global ambassador. His films have historically drawn significant box office numbers both domestically and overseas, shaping audience tastes. Strategic analysis of his prior hits reveals the superstar’s unique ability to blend mass appeal with evolving cinematic trends, a factor expected to heavily influence King's penetration in 2026 markets.

Comparative Analysis with Previous Blockbusters
| Movie | Release Year | Box Office (INR Cr) | Main Cast | OTT Platform Release Time (Months) |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Raees | 2017 | 281 | Shah Rukh Khan | 6 |
| Padmaavat | 2018 | 585 | Deepika Padukone | 5 |
| Pathaan | 2023 | 1000+ | Shah Rukh Khan | 3 |
| King | 2026 (Projected) | 850-1000 (Projection) | Shah Rukh Khan, Deepika Padukone | 4 |
| Laal Singh Chaddha | 2022 | 200 | Aamir Khan | 6 |
